Hello! I'm

Rajesh
Ojha

a Software Quality Engineer/SDET working at
walmart-logo Walmart.

rajesh ojha

What I do

I'm a passionate coder with a knack for creating robust automation testing frameworks tailored for iOS, Android, and Desktop applications. My expertise lies in crafting automation infrastructures that go beyond the ordinary, seamlessly using modern tools such as Selenium, Appium, Cypress, JMeter, RestAssured, and more.

Beyond my coding prowess, I'm fueled by a fervent interest in exploratory testing. From meticulously reviewing product requirements, functional, and design specifications to meticulously preparing test strategies and cases, I cover every aspect of ensuring the highest product quality.

  • Automation Testing

    Developing automation testing frameworks for iOS, Android and Desktop applications.

  • API Testing

    Validating the functionality, reliability, performance, and security of API using Postman, SoapUI, Rest-Assured.

  • Performance Testing

    Testing speed, scalability, and reliability using tools such as JMeter, LoadRunner, and Gatling.

  • End-to-end Testing

    Practical approach in performing end to end functional testing, ensuring the highest product quality.

Career
History

walmart

Senior Quality Engineer

Walmart Global Tech

Jan 2021 - Present • 2 yrs 11 mos

Responsible for end to end Quality assurance of customer experience org initiatives in Walmart. Work closely with the Developers and other stakeholders to achieve a high level of code coverage and improve product quality which can improve the customer experience. Expertise in designing and implementing core features in Test Automation Frameworks (Web and Mobile apps) using NightWatch, Java Script and TestArmada etc. Understand the business requirements, use cases, design patterns to create test plans, test cases, milestones.

intelliswift

Technical Lead

Intelliswift Software

Oct 2017 - Dec 2020 • 3 yrs 2 mos

Deployed at WALMART LABS, Bangalore as a Quality Engineer (Contractor). I work as part of US customer experience team to understand and analyze product requirements, perform functional testing of Desktop and Mobile applications and create Automation scripts using a Javascript based framework. The automation tests run on the Desktop, iOS, and Android applications to perform regression testing. It integrates multiple automation infrastructures and effectively identifies vulnerabilities at an early stage.

proarch

SENIOR TEST ENGINEER

PROARCH IT SOLUTIONS

Apr 2016 – Sep 2017 • 1 yr 5 mos

I lead a team of Quality Engineers, and actively developed test scripts on a Selenium C# based automation framework. The framework runs on Browserstack and integrates Continuous Integration, cross-browser testing, parallel execution support, etc. I was also involved in reviewing product requirements, functional and design specifications to prepare test cases and perform end to end functional testing.

neosoft

SENIOR SOFTWARE TESTER

NEOSOFT TECHNOLOGIES

Jan 2015 - Mar 2016 • 1 yr 2 mos

My role was to create, execute and maintain test assets, to undertake functional and non-functional tests on the product in accordance to the test plan and test strategy, to develop coded automation scripts using Cucumber, Gherkin, Selenium and Java. Worked as part of both the Quality Assurance team and the sprint team supporting the team’s performance goals. Mentor and provide advice to colleagues where necessary.

freelance

QUALITY ENGINEER

FREELANCE

Dec 2012 - Jan 2015 • 2 yrs 1 mo

Worked as a Freelance tester in multiple software testing projects on e-commerce, healthcare domains. Contributed to end to end software testing cycle and developed automation frameworks using different tools such as Selenium IDE, WebDriver, etc.. Involved in Analyzing the User requirements, deriving the Test Scenarios and designing the manual test cases, generating the test data and preparing the weekly status reports, manual test execution and various testing phases like Sanity, Functional, Retesting, System and Smoke Testing.